About The Position

This is an individual contributor position responsible for performing most functions of the preventive and repair maintenance, electrical, electronic and mechanical work for the Utility Division with proficiency. The Maintenance Technician is also responsible for fabrication of fixtures using welding, cutting and soldering. Associate must adhere to Valmont safety training policies. The Maintenance Technician performs preventive maintenance and repairs on all plant equipment and facilities with a learned level of proficiency. This person is also responsible for maintaining and repairing plant equipment, including pneumatic and mechanical systems, clutches, brakes, combustion engines, and electrical and hydraulic systems. The associate performs basic electrical work and fabricates fixtures with limited to no instruction. This person is responsible for documenting the amount of labor used and materials used on each repair in MaintainX.

Responsibilities

  • Test, inspect, repair, troubleshoot and re-assemble basic plant equipment, components, and systems including but not limited to overhead bridge cranes, hoists, gear boxes, forklifts, straddle trucks, company vehicles, pneumatic and mechanical systems, combustion engines electrical and hydraulic systems
  • Perform basic electrical work and assist in highly skilled electrical work
  • Fabricate fixtures using welding, cutting, soldering, and surface hardening applications
  • Communicate with supervisor and other maintenance and production team members via e-mail, phone, and face-to-face
  • Responsible for working with small hand tools including tape measures, micrometers, saws, drills, riveters, and nail guns and maintaining tools and equipment
  • Complete record logs including labor, repairs made, equipment, and use of materials on the computer
  • Ability to fabricate and repair metal structures and components
  • Perform calibarations on various equipment
  • Responsible for reading basic blueprints
